In general form, we use the parameterBand the relation $latex P = \frac{2 \pi}{|B|}$ to calculate the period of the function. In the general formula, is related to the period by If then the period is less than and the function undergoes a horizontal compression, whereas if then the period is greater than and the function undergoes a horizontal stretch. The sin graph is a visual representation of the sine function for a given range of angles. The horizontal axis of a trigonometric graph represents the angle, usually written as theta , and the y -axis is the sine function of that angle.
